Ciphr has an exciting opportunity for a Senior Cloud Software Development Engineer in Test (SDET) to join the team as we grow and develop. You’ll be responsible for leading testing of the software suite. The objective is to gain a deep understanding of software under test, analysis of repetitive tasks and automating them where appropriate to improve the efficiency of the team and the quality of the products. This role works closely with the engineering team, the customer care team and the product management team to provide robust and intuitive software, delivering the best user experience for our clients.

See below the daily tasks of Senior Cloud Software Development Engineer in Test:
- Lead the development and implementation of comprehensive test strategies and plans.
- Design, develop, and maintain automated test frameworks and scripts.
- Triage issues raised from other teams within the business to understand priorities and ensure all necessary information is present for work to be completed.
- Mentor and guide junior SDETs and QA engineers.
- Analysis of repetitive tests and delivery of high-quality, non-brittle, automated solutions.
- Management, design, implementation and maintenance of integrated and E2E system tests.
- Perform both manual as well as automated testing.
- Supporting the development team in designing high value unit tests.
- Working closely with developers within an Agile sprint team to refine & estimate items of work and other Agile ceremonies.

About Ciphr:
Ciphr is a leading UK-based provider of integrated HR, payroll, learning and recruitment solutions. Ciphr’s integrated HCM platform helps organisations manage their end-to-end employee lifecycle so they can deliver an amazing employee experience. With Ciphr, organisations can be confident they can access all their people data in one place, thanks to secure, time-saving integrations between our own solutions and API connections to specialist, third-party tools.
